    Rockman 9 Video Problem / forcing a Wii to 480p

    I posted about this in the first play thread but between all the people (understandably enough) talking about the game and the obscurity of the question it got a bit lost, and was wondering if anyone else might be able to help.

    I've got one of the VDigi Wii VGA cables, and use it to connect a Japanese Wii to my monitor. When you originally connect the lead, you need to first plug in the console via a 'normal' video lead (i.e. composite) and set it to 480p before plugging in the VGA lead, as this is the only way it works. Up until now this has been fine, seeing as all JPN Wii games & VC titles run in 480p - only issue I've seen has been some GC games - couldn't say whether this was the majority or not, but on those that aren't in progressive scan, there's no video signal reaching the monitor.

    This has become a bit more of an issue since Rockman 9 got released, as it would seem this is the first actual Wii title that runs in 480i rather than 480p. It's more than a little annoying finding this out after paying for it, and also knowing that it's being done for the 'retro feel'... yet if I were to buy Rockman 2 from the VC instead it would be quite happy in 480p.

    Anyone having a similar problem, or thought of a way around? Unless there's an option in-game to change things I'm coming up blank.
